    U.S. Air Force Staff Sgt. Brady Christensen (left), 56th Security Forces Squadron military working dog handler, KKora (middle), 56th SFS military working dog, and Staff Sgt. Henry Pearson (right), 56th SFS military working dog handler, showcase bite drills during an Honorary Commander immersion, Feb. 4, 2025, at Luke Air Force Base, Arizona. The demonstration highlighted the expertise of MWD teams in detecting threats and protecting personnel. The immersion served as a platform for HCCs to gain valuable insights into the 56th Fighter Wing’s mission and capabilities. (U.S. Air Force photo by Senior Airman Mason Hargrove)
